About Applovin Corporation

AppLovin provides a software platform for mobile app developers to market, monetize, and analyze their apps. Its AI-powered tools help developers grow their business by connecting them with global advertising networks.

About Synchrony Financial

Synchrony Financial is a premier consumer financial services company and the largest provider of private-label credit cards in the United States. Spun off from GE Capital in 2014, it operates through a unique B2B2C model, embedding its financing products within the ecosystems of major partners like Amazon, Lowe’s, and PayPal. Synchrony leverages deep data analytics and a diverse multi-platform strategy—spanning retail, health, and auto—to drive customer loyalty and provide specialized credit solutions at the point of sale.
